Increase 400litres by 20%
Sati [7]

Answer:

480 Litres

Step-by-step explanation:

Percentage increase = 20% × 400

New value =

400 + Percentage increase =

400 + (20% × 400) =

400 + 20% × 400 =

(1 + 20%) × 400 =

(100% + 20%) × 400 =

120% × 400 =

120 ÷ 100 × 400 =

120 × 400 ÷ 100 =

48,000 ÷ 100 =

480
